Kamal Kishore

Special Representative for Disaster Risk Reduction, United Nations Office for Disaster Risk Reduction (UNDRR)

Kamal Kishore is the Special Representative of the United Nations Secretary-General (SRSG) for Disaster Risk Reduction, and Head of the United Nations Office for Disaster Risk Reduction (UNDRR), based in Geneva, Switzerland.

Mr Kishore brings to this position nearly three decades of experience in disaster risk reduction, climate action and sustainable development at the global, regional, national and local levels, having worked in government, the United Nations and civil society organizations.

Prior to joining UNDRR, Mr Kishore was the Head of Department of the National Disaster Management Authority of India, where he led the G20 Working Group on Disaster Risk Reduction and contributed to the development of the Coalition for Disaster Resilient Infrastructure.

Mr Kishore spent nearly 13 years with the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) in New York, Geneva, and New Delhi where he contributed to advancing policy and supported post-disaster recovery in Bangladesh, Iran, Maldives, Myanmar, Pakistan, the Philippines and Sri Lanka.

Prior to UNDP, he served as Director of Information and Research, and Manager of Extreme Climate Events Programme at the Asian Disaster Preparedness Centre in Bangkok (1996-2002), covering Indonesia, the Philippines, and Vietnam and as an Architect at the Action Research Unit for Development (1992-1994) in New Delhi where he worked on post-earthquake reconstruction projects.
